liberated
verb
- 1
To set free, to make or allow to be free, particularly
- 2
To acquire from an enemy during wartime, used especially of cities, regions, and other population centers.
- 3
To acquire from another by theft or force: to steal, to rob.
“We didn't need IDs. We just liberated these beers from the back of the shop.”
adjective
- 1
Freed, especially from traditional ideas in social and sexual matters.
